Nighttic: A Hypercasual Puzzle That Turns Your Brain into a Chessboard

Nighttic mixes classic tic‑tac‑toe tactics with a chess‑like block‑out system. One swipe, one tap, and the board reshapes itself. Every move matters because a single mistake lets the opponent claim the win. Nighttic Mechanics

The control scheme is stripped down to the essentials. Tap any empty cell to place your mark, then watch the board react. The AI opponent reacts instantly, forcing you to think two steps ahead. No menus, no clutter—just pure, addictive play.

Nighttic Strategy

Winning isn’t about random clicks. Start by claiming the center cell; it offers the most lines of attack. Then, watch the opponent’s pattern and block any three‑in‑a‑row before it forms. The game rewards foresight: a well‑timed block can flip the board’s balance in seconds. As you clear levels, new board sizes appear, each demanding tighter spatial awareness. Keep an eye on the timer—quick decisions earn bonus points that boost your leaderboard rank.
